logo

Output 39c293438871361c718de694288632e29ececb8c9b1f550ac84266fee2903e25:4

value
50000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9b94bea421b8b4d8defcd9aa57c57d57650235b5 OP_EQUALVERIFY OP_CHECKSIG
address
1FBdvhNffJn6JpjWp2H4X1EUYiXyeNoWDa
transaction
39c293438871361c718de694288632e29ececb8c9b1f550ac84266fee2903e25